CASPER (Concentration And Shape Parameter Estimation Routine)

Casper is a python package aimed at predicting the concentration and shape parameter of dark matter haloes as a function of mass and redshift for a specified cosmology.

Requirements

The module requires the following:

  • python3.6 or higher

Installation

The easiest way to install Casper is using pip:

pip install py-casper [--user]

The --user flag may be required if you do not have root privileges. Alternatively for a more involved 'installation' that is also editable you can simply clone the github repository:

git clone https://github.com/Shaun-T-Brown/CASPER.git

and add the folder (specifically src) to your python path. This method will also require scipy and numpy to be installed. Using pip will automatically install all dependencies.

To use the main functionality of the package (i.e. to predict c and alpha) you will need to be able to generate the linear power spectra for a given cosmology. In principle this can be done using any reliable method. However, we recommend installing and using CAMB.

Usage

The best way to demonstrate how Casper can be used is with a few examples. An interactive jupyter notebook with all necessary modules available can be found on Binder. A static version of the same notebook can be found at the following github repository, specifically in the file example_script.ipynb.

The functionality of the package is relatively straightforward and is essentially a collection of useful functions centered around the density profiles of dark matter haloes. Basic documentation can be generated using pydoc.

import casper

help(casper)
